Deploying Precision Messengers
Peptide protocols are the equivalent of a software update for your cells. These small chains of amino acids are signaling agents that instruct your body to perform specific, targeted actions with high fidelity. Unlike broad hormonal adjustments, peptides can be selected to achieve very distinct outcomes. This targeted approach allows for a level of precision that was previously unavailable.
- A compound like BPC-157 acts as a rapid-deployment repair crew, accelerating the healing of connective tissues and reducing systemic inflammation after intense physical or mental exertion.
- Specific peptide blends such as CJC-1295 and Ipamorelin work synergistically to optimize the body’s own release of growth hormone during sleep, directly enhancing recovery, metabolic health, and cellular regeneration.
- Other peptides can cross the blood-brain barrier, offering targeted support for cognitive functions and neuronal health.
